Cops say a 24-year-old pregnant woman was punched in the face by an unidentified assailant in her late 20s riding the No. 4 train at 138th Street/Grand Concourse Sunday night. The pregnant woman then fought back by pulling a folding knife and slashing the woman's left arm. The Post reports that the "attacker fled"... having realized that she couldn't throw this momma from the train. Tip your waitress!

Park Slope Resident Attacked, Slashed
Last week an ex-con attacked a woman in Park Slope, and the news is hitting the papers today. The NY Post reports that 32-year-old Thomas Russo followed 39-year-old Diana Greiner along 6th Avenue in Brooklyn last Tuesday around 11:45 p.m. Somewhere near Lincoln Place, Russo struck Greiner's skull (fracturing it) and slashed her face and body before fleeing on foot into a bodega. He was caught on tape and is currently being charged with attempted murder, assault and criminal possession of a weapon. Russo had violated his parole in April, but was still free to roam the streets; his prior run-ins with the law included attempted robbery and marijuana possession.
